Milwaukee Womens Center Inc

Organization Overview

Milwaukee Womens Center Inc is located in Milwaukee, WI. The organization was established in 2007. According to its NTEE Classification (P11) the organization is classified as: Single Organization Support, under the broad grouping of Human Services and related organizations. This organization is an independent organization and not affiliated with a larger national or regional group of organizations. Milwaukee Womens Center Inc is a 501(c)(3) and as such, is described as a "Charitable or Religous organization or a private foundation" by the IRS.

For the year ending 12/2021, Milwaukee Womens Center Inc generated $1.3m in total revenue. This represents relatively stable growth, over the past 7 years the organization has increased revenue by an average of 0.5% each year. All expenses for the organization totaled $1.4m during the year ending 12/2021. While expenses have increased by 0.9% per year over the past 7 years. They've been increasing with an increasing level of total revenue. You can explore the organizations financials more deeply in the financial statements section below.

Describe the Organization's Mission:

Part 3 - Line 1

THE MILWAUKEE WOMEN'S CENTER, INC., A WISCONSIN NOT-FOR-PROFIT CORPORATION, PROVIDES INNOVATIVE, CULTURALLY COMPETENT HOLISTIC CARE THAT WILL EMPOWER MEN, WOMEN, AND CHILDREN TO LIVE SAFE, INDEPENDENT, AND HEALTHY LIVES.

Describe the Organization's Program Activity:

Part 3 - Line 4a

DURING 2021, THE MILWAUKEE WOMEN'S CENTER SERVED 1,025 MEN, WOMEN, AND CHILDREN. SERVICES PROVIDED INCLUDE: EMERGENCY TRANSPORTATION AND SHELTER FOR INDIVIDUALS AND FAMILIES AFFECTED BY DOMESTIC VIOLENCE AND HOMELESSNESS; A 24-HOUR CRISIS HOTLINE; FOOD, CLOTHING, TOILETRIES, AND PERSONAL CARE ITEMS; COUNSELING AND SUPPORT GROUPS TO ADDRESS DOMESTIC VIOLENCE, SUBSTANCE USE DISORDERS, AND HEALTHY PARENTING; SPECIALIZED SERVICES AND SUPPORT FOR CHILDREN AND OLDER ABUSED WOMEN; CASE MANAGEMENT TO HELP THOSE IN OUR CARE MEET THEIR HOUSING, EMPLOYMENT, LEGAL, AND OTHER BASIC NEEDS; BATTERERS' PREVENTION AND INTERVENTION EDUCATION; FATHERHOOD PROGRAMMING; INTENSIVE OUTPATIENT SUBSTANCE USE DISORDER TREATMENT; AND CAREER APPROPRIATE FREE CLOTHING AND ACCESSORIES TO MEN AND WOMEN SEEKING EMPLOYMENT OPPORTUNITIES. THE EMERGENCY SHELTER CONTINUED TO OPERATE 24/7 WHILE OTHER SERVICES WERE PROVIDED IN SMALL GROUPS OR REMOTELY OVER THE PHONE, VIA EMAIL, AND THROUGH VIDEO CONFERENCING.
